Finally, URL shortening sites provide detailed information on the clicks a link receives, which can be simpler than setting up an equally powerful server-side analytics engine, and unlike the latter, does not require any access to the server.
It is a legitimate concern that many existing URL shortening services may not have a sustainable business model in the long term.[12] In late 2009, the Internet Archive started the "301 Works" projects,[25] together with twenty collaborating companies (initially), whose short URLs will be preserved by the project.[12] The URL shortening service ur1.ca provides its entire database as a file download, so if its website stops working, other websites may be able to provide ways to correct broken links to URLs shortened with its service.
